Abstract


Climate change presents a significant hazard to public health in Bangladesh, intensifying disease outbreaks, hunger, and mental health disorders, while placing additional pressure on an already vulnerable healthcare system. This study investigates the relationship between climate change and public health policies, assessing the adaptation of policy frameworks to environmental issues. The study assesses public knowledge, health risks, and policy efficacy using a sample size of 450 respondents. Research reveals that although governmental initiatives are there, deficiencies in healthcare infrastructure, financial resources, and coordination impede efficient execution. The research emphasizes the necessity for a more data-informed, community-oriented, and adequately financed public health approach to address climate-related health hazards. Recommendations encompass fortifying legislative frameworks, augmenting healthcare accessibility, and amplifying community involvement to bolster climate resilience within Bangladesh's healthcare sector.
